slide1 n.
Download
Skip this Video
Loading SlideShow in 5 Seconds..
Oracle XML Publisher Enterprise Reporting and Delivery PowerPoint Presentation
Download Presentation
Oracle XML Publisher Enterprise Reporting and Delivery

Loading in 2 Seconds...

play fullscreen
1 / 44

Oracle XML Publisher Enterprise Reporting and Delivery - PowerPoint PPT Presentation


  • 99 Views
  • Uploaded on

Oracle XML Publisher Enterprise Reporting and Delivery. Steve Sako Principal Application Technology Sales Consultant Oracle USA, Inc. steve.sako@oracle.com. Why XML Publisher ?. Checks. Reports. Labels. Destinations. Document Management Requirements. Rich Formatted Reports

loader
I am the owner, or an agent authorized to act on behalf of the owner, of the copyrighted work described.
capcha
Download Presentation

PowerPoint Slideshow about 'Oracle XML Publisher Enterprise Reporting and Delivery' - huong


An Image/Link below is provided (as is) to download presentation

Download Policy: Content on the Website is provided to you AS IS for your information and personal use and may not be sold / licensed / shared on other websites without getting consent from its author.While downloading, if for some reason you are not able to download a presentation, the publisher may have deleted the file from their server.


- - - - - - - - - - - - - - - - - - - - - - - - - - E N D - - - - - - - - - - - - - - - - - - - - - - - - - -
Presentation Transcript
slide1

Oracle XML PublisherEnterprise Reporting and Delivery

Steve Sako

Principal Application Technology Sales Consultant

Oracle USA, Inc.

steve.sako@oracle.com

document management requirements

Checks

Reports

Labels

Destinations

Document Management Requirements
  • Rich Formatted Reports
  • Partner Reports
  • Financial Statements
  • Government forms
  • Marketing materials
  • Contracts
  • Checks, Labels
  • XML
  • EFT / EDI
  • Multiple destinations

Invoices

XML / EFT / EDI

no one system can do that

Checks

Invoices

Reports

Destinations

No One System Can Do That
  • 3rd party software and custom solutions are required to satisfy business requirements
  • Costly
  • Time consuming
  • Complex systems

Check Print

Server

Invoice

Server

Label

Manager

Report

Formatter

Labels

Delivery

Server

Payment

Server

XML / EFT / EDI

maintenance costs more

Checks

Invoices

Reports

Destinations

Maintenance Costs More
  • Highly-skilled engineers required to maintain the 3rd party software servers
  • Costly
  • Time consuming
  • Complex systems
  • Expensive maintenance
  • Labor intensive

Check Print

Server

Invoice

Server

Label

Manager

Report

Formatter

Labels

Delivery

Server

Payment

Server

XML / EFT / EDI

integrated document management

Checks

XML Publisher

Reports

Labels

Destinations

Integrated Document Management
  • Oracle XML Publisher
    • Authoring
    • Managing
    • Delivering

Your Business Documents

  • Meet Business Requirements
  • Remove Complexity
  • Reduce Maintenance Cost
  • Reduce Total Cost

Invoices

XML / EFT / EDI

xml publisher concept
XML Publisher Concept

Separate data / layout / UI translation

Data Logic

Layout

XML Publisher

Reportoutput

Translation

  • Flexibility
  • Reduced maintenance
xml publisher customization
XML Publisher Customization
  • 1 data set : 10 layout templates
  • Business consultants use familiar

desktop tools for layout customization

  • Support for hosted customers

XSL

Report Templates

XSL-FO

Report Output

XML Data

XML

EFT

  • Rapid Deployment
slide12

P D F

X L S

R T F

X S L

Industry Standard Templates

  • Using desktop applications
    • Adobe Acrobat
    • MS Word
    • MS Excel
    • XSL Editors
security
Security
  • Printing from Excel is not accepted by financial auditors
  • PDF Security levels for
    • Read only / Editable
    • Copy Text
    • Printable
    • Password protection
language support
No need for expensive language-specific printers

XML Publisher ships with full set of Unicode Fonts

Scalable font embedding, with CID mapping tables

XML Publisher is alone in supporting

CJK

BiDi

Unicode

MLS

Compare to

others

Language Support
tagging text as placeholders
Tagging text as placeholders
  • Use standard xml PI(processing instruction) syntax:

<? Place Holder ?>

  • Write placeholders in two ways
    • In normal text
    • In form field’s help text
in normal text
In normal text
  • Put XML Elements directly into RTF text

<employeeid="1">

<name>Edward Jiang</name>

<location>6OP</location>

<office>E211</office>

</employee>

in form field s help text
In form field’s help text
  • Insert a form field, put in description, click “Add Help Text…”, and put text in the text area below…

<employeeid="1">

<name>Edward Jiang</name>

<location>6OP</location>

<office>E211</office>

</employee>

repeating groups
Repeating groups
  • <?for-each:group_element_name?> … Stuff to be repeated …<?end for-each?>

<employees>

<employeeid="1">

<name>Edward Jiang</name>

<location>6OP</location>

<office>E211</office>

</employee>

<employeeid=“2">

<name>Shinji Yoshida</name>

<location>6OP</location>

<office>259</office>

</employee>

</employees>

simple conditional formatting if condition
Simple Conditional Formatting<?if:condition?>
  • Display data only if name is “Shinji Yoshida”

<employees>

<employeeid="1">

<name>Edward Jiang</name>

<location>6OP</location>

<office>E211</office>

</employee>

<employeeid=“2">

<name>Shinji Yoshida</name>

<location>6OP</location>

<office>259</office>

</employee>

</employees>

11i10 apps products utilizing xml publisher
HRMS

DBI/PMV

Purchasing

Contracts

Sourcing

Quoting

FSG

eRecords

Loans

Financials Consolidation Hub

AP / AR / FA

11i10 Apps Products UtilizingXML Publisher
  • Order Management
  • iStore
  • Project Contracts
  • Marketing
  • Student Services
  • Discrete Manufacturing
  • Process Manufacturing
  • Bill Presentment
  • Internal Controls Manager
  • Global Financials
  • Sub Ledger Accounting
  • SCM
  • Projects
oracle human resources
Oracle Human Resources

Human Resources

Business Requirements

  • Generate Employee tax forms
  • Support multiple states and continuation pages
  • Single and Batch processing
  • Access from Self Service

Implementation

  • PDF Form Templates
  • XMLP Common Regions
  • XML APIs (Batch)
oracle payments
Oracle Payments

Payments

Business Requirements

  • Generate Electronic Funds Transfer files
  • Support 160 formats
  • Very large data input support
  • Deliver via FTP, HTTP

Implementation

  • eText Templates
  • Delivery Manager
oracle sourcing
Oracle Sourcing

Sourcing

Business Requirements

  • Generate integrated output with Contract info
  • Advanced formatting
  • Self service interaction

Implementation

  • RTF/XSLFO Templates
  • Multiple data sources /templates
  • Integrated into self service application
oracle financials
Oracle Financials

Financials

Business Requirements

  • Generate High Fidelity Output
  • Allow end user customization
  • 10000+ page output
  • No change for report consumers

Implementation

  • RTF Templates
  • Scalable transformation
  • Concurrent Manager Integration
oracle daily business intelligence
Oracle Daily Business Intelligence

DBI

Business Requirements

  • Generate High Fidelity Output from HTML
  • User level customization
  • Support Images/ Charts
  • Support dynamic links

Implementation

  • RTF Templates
  • Charting support
  • Advanced layout features
slide38
NCR

Business Requirements

  • Generate Bill of Lading
  • Barcode support
  • Multiple Delivery Channels
  • Supplemental Pages

Implementation

  • RTF Templates
  • Conditional Formatting
  • External Font Mapping
  • Delivery Manager
t3 energy services
T3 Energy Services

Business Requirements

  • Generate Checks
  • Signature Security
  • Multiple Delivery Channels

Implementation

  • RTF Templates
  • External Font Mapping
  • Virtual Signature Images
  • Concurrent Manager Integration
  • Delivery Manager
calgary board of education
Calgary Board of Education

Business Requirements

  • Generate Executive Reports
  • Multiple Delivery Channels
  • High Fidelity Output
  • No change for end users

Implementation

  • RTF Templates
  • Concurrent Manager Integration
  • Delivery Manager
government of dubai
Government of Dubai

Business Requirements

  • Generate HR Reports
  • Multiple Font Handling
  • Advanced BIDI Support

Implementation

  • RTF Templates
  • Advanced BIDI Options in FO Layer
  • Utilize MS Word for Advanced Text Formatting
dell inc
Dell Inc

Business Requirements

  • Generate Customer Facing Output
  • Multiple Data Sources
  • Translation support
  • Multiple Delivery Channels
  • High Volume ~10000 docs/hr
  • Keep database load to a minimum

Implementation

  • RTF Templates
  • Delivery Manager
  • Watermarking support
  • Install XMLP on separate server
slide43

Q

&

Q U E S T I O N S

A N S W E R S

A